I've just posted an abbreviated version of the Campaign 1814 mod to the downloads section.

It's similar to my mod for Campaign Leipzig and currently comes in eight parts.

Several parts that are currently completed but untested have been (temporarily) left out of the mod release to save time.

What you get:

Units images with cannons, horses, and flag backgrounds. Makes it easier to distinguish between infantry, cavalry, and artillery. Armies from minor nations are immediately recognizable because their flag background is not limited to that of the main side.

Example: suppose you are in command of a Prussian forcs with some Russian, Saxon, and Badener units attched. In this mod it will be immediately apparent which units are Prussian and which ones aren't because, although the units on the 2D map will all appear in prussian blue, when you click on them for more information their unit images will have their national flags clear displayed as a background.

Panzer Campaigns-style grass, roads, and trees on the 2D map.

Slightly modified Ezjax terrain on the 3D map.

A shortcut icon derived from Meissonier's iconic painting that can be used on your desktop.

I've just given the 1814 mod a major overhaul and gathered it together all in one place.



Besides getting all the different pieces of the mod under one roof, I've repainted the 3D trees to look like leafless trees in the French winter. I've also redrawn and repainted the 3D unit bases (they now have the same color as the background of the unitbox) and repaired and repositioned the units so that they usually look like they're centered on the bases. This includes some corrections to the 3D zoomed out bases that have been retro-fitted onto Campaign Leipzig.



I've also done some work on the sound. I didn't like hearing someone yelling "God save the King" in the background of battles that were being fought between non-English speakers, so I edited out about four seconds of background sound. I've also never been a fan of the music selections, so I replaced the victory music with some period music selections. There's even an alternate for the draw music: if you don't like Beethoven there's an alternate clip of a French military bank giving the signal to pack it in for the night.



Like my other Napoleonic mods, I've included horses, cannons, and wagons so you won't be able to mistake a couple of teamsters for a battalion of infantry. The cannon images have been painted with gun carriages and metal fittings in the appropriate national colors.

The Campaign 1814 mod has been updated to version 2.2.

The update was needed to correct problems with how infantry units in column rested on their bases.

This isn't strictly part of the mod, but I've included a small gallery of paintings of battles from the Campagne de France to give the mod a bit more context.

Although not well known, the Campaign of 1814 was one of Napoleon's finest, and ranks alongside his first campaign in Italy as a showcase for his mastery of the battlefield. If Waterloo had gone his way, the ensuing campaign would have been an attempt to repeat the Campagne de France with a fresher army in better weather.
